RAILWAY TIME-TABLE

NO ALTERATION. New Plymouth has hee:i*greatly agitated for some time past lest in the framing of the .Main Trunk railway service the New Plymouth section would ho relegated to a secondary position. U one tune there was every reason to believe, on the authority of the District Irallic Manager, that the arrival of the mail train at New Plymouth was to be considerably delayed, and the various local bodies and semi-public institutions iu the district made representations to the Minister of Railways protesting against this retrogressive stop, and pointing out the serious damage that must accrue to Taranaki's interests by instituting a train service that would so detrimentally dislocate the New Plymouth to Onehunga steam service. The Hon. J. A. Millar, Minister of Railways, conversing with a Daily News representative last night, imparted the very pleasing information that there would be no change whatever in the Wellington-New Plymouth mail train service. This line and the Main Trunk would be run quite independently of 'each other as two services. For 'his own part, lie could not see how the .Main Trunk line would get much Auckland traffic from Wanganui and northwards, although for a year or so many people, even from New Plymouth, would travel to Auckland by rail, tempted by the novelty of the thing. After that he thought this service would hold its own fairly well. As for the present fallingofT in passenger traffic, lit was th« usual slackness after the holiday season.
